Growing Information
Common Name: St. Tropez Floribunda Rose
Botanical Name: Rosa Floribunda 'St. Tropez'
Plant Type: Deciduous flowering shrub
Growth Stage: Established one-year-old plant
Sun Requirements: Full sun (6–8+ hours daily)
Soil: Rich, well-draining soil with organic matter
Watering: Moderate; keep soil evenly moist during establishment
Mature Height: 3–5 feet tall
Growth Rate: Moderate
USDA Zones: 5–10
Container Friendly: Yes

Care Tip: Plant your rose in a sunny location with good airflow for optimal flowering and plant health. Apply a balanced rose fertilizer during the growing season and deadhead spent blooms regularly to encourage repeat flowering.
